Short answer: the Adam Audio T8V for better sound quality, the Adam Audio T7V for the lower price. The Adam Audio T8V ranks #22 of 31 powered bookshelf speakers at $349.99. The Adam Audio T7V ranks #23 at $289.99, $60 cheaper.

What the Adam Audio T7V offers: Quite balanced and neutral, very close to the Yamaha HS8. Watch for: On-axis response is a bit wider than ideal for a nearfield monitor, and narrow vertical dispersion means you need to sit at tweeter height to get the intended tonal balance, per Audioholics’ measurements.

What the Adam Audio T8V offers: Quite balanced and neutral, very close to the Yamaha HS8. Watch for: A crossover-region notch around 4.6kHz where tweeter and woofer interact, and a hole in the vertical response below the tweeter axis - keep the tweeter at or above ear height.

Buy the Adam Audio T7V if the price matters more than sound quality. Buy the Adam Audio T8V if sound quality matters more than the price.

Pros: Quite balanced and neutral, very close to the Yamaha HS8. Deeper bass than the HS8

Cons: On-axis response is a bit wider than ideal for a nearfield monitor, and narrow vertical dispersion means you need to sit at tweeter height to get the intended tonal balance, per Audioholics’ measurements. Frequency response below 1kHz also looks a bit ragged in the digitized ASR analysis - not as smooth out of the box as some rivals, though it’s said to respond well to EQ.

Pros: Quite balanced and neutral, very close to the Yamaha HS8. Deeper bass than the HS8

Cons: A crossover-region notch around 4.6kHz where tweeter and woofer interact, and a hole in the vertical response below the tweeter axis - keep the tweeter at or above ear height. Distortion is well controlled at 86dB SPL but gets messier at 96dB.
